Karta Vacation Rentals
In Houghton Estate, in the heart of Johannesburg, a short drive from Johannesburg Zoo and the South African National Museum of Military History. Rosebank Mall, Melrose Arch and Victory Theater are all close by, and O.R. Tambo International Airport is about 22 km away.